We don’t provide backups for temporary suspensions.

You have to consider that for you to get access the file, the following needs to happen:

  1. You need to notice the account is suspended.
  2. You need to submit a ticket to ask for the backup.
  3. We need to see the ticket where you’re asking for the backup.
  4. We need to generate the backup.
  5. We need to send the backup link to you.
  6. You need to download the backup using the backup link we sent you.

In most cases, these steps can easily take the better part of 24 hours depending on when the steps are done (e.g. sleep schedules) and how busy everyone is (ticket queues on our end, other activities on your end).

And even if you have the backup, then what do you want to do with it? Migrate the website elsewhere? DNS propagation alone can take up to 72 hours, which is much longer than the suspension and also causes downtime.

So really, the fastest way to get your website back online is to just wait for your account to be reactivated automatically.

If you want to migrate your website elsewhere regardless, you can already start by setting up your new hosting and pointing the domain over, and simply migrate the website when your account comes back online.

But we’re not going to spend staff time and server power just so you can download your files a few hours earlier than you would be able to otherwise.
